Skip to Main Content
Needham Bank Logo
Locations
  • Personal Banking
  • Business Banking
  • Personal Credit Card
  • Business Credit Card
Customer Care Center: 781-444-2100
  • Contact Us
  • About
  • Community
  • Careers
  • Enroll in Online Banking
  • Personal Banking
  • Business Banking
  • Personal Credit Card
  • Business Credit Card
Enroll in Online Banking
Needham Bank Logo
Small Needham Bank Logo
  • Overview

    Checking

    • NB Debit Mastercard®
    • NB Money Management
    • Zelle® - Send and Receive Money

    Savings

    • Interest Rates
    • NB Statement Savings
    • NB Money Market
    • Personal CDs and IRAs

    Online & Mobile Banking

    Wealth Management

    Consumer Loans

    • Home Equity Line of Credit (HELOC)
    • Overdraft Protection Line of Credit
    • Personal Loans
    • Auto Loans

    Credit Cards

    • NB Rewards Mastercard®
    • NB Credit Advantage Mastercard®

    Residential Loans

    • First-Time Home Buyer Program
    • Fixed-Rate Mortgages
    • Adjustable Rate Mortgages
    • 40-Year Mortgage*
    • Community Loan Program
    • Construction-to-Permanent Mortgages
    • Home Equity Line of Credit (HELOC)
    • Jumbo Mortgages
    • Portfolio Loans
    • NB WealthBuilder Mortgage
    • Residential Loan Rates
    • Mortgage Calculators
    • Meet the Residential Lending Team

    Learn

    • Calculators & Tools
    • Knowledge Center
    • Fraud Prevention Tips

    Quickly open a Checking, Savings, CD or Money Market online in just 5 minutes. Open an Account Now

  • Overview

    Checking

    • NB Business Checking
    • NB Corporate Checking

    Savings

    • NB Business Money Market
    • NB Business CDs
    • Simplified Employee Pension (SEP) IRAs

    Credit Card

    • NB Business Rewards Mastercard®

    Online & Mobile Banking

    Cash Management

    Features include:

    • Cash Flow Management
    • Collections/Receivables
    • Disbursements/Payables
    • Fraud Prevention
    • Direct Connect for Quicken and Quickbooks

    Municipal Banking

    Wealth Management

    ZDeposit

    ZRent

    Commercial Banking

    • Commercial Real Estate Loans
    • Small Business
    • Middle Market
    • Structured Finance
    • Cannabis Banking
    • Meet our Commercial Team Leaders

    Learn

    • Business Resource Center
    • Business Banking Client Profiles
    • Knowledge Center
    • Fraud Prevention Tips

    Loans & Lines of Credit

    • Business Loans
    • Business Overdraft Protection
    • Construction Loans
    • Small Business Administration (SBA) Loans
    • Small Business Term Loan
    • Commercial Real Estate Loans
    • Paycheck Protection Program Loan Forgiveness

    Partner with Needham Bank experts who are invested in your success.

  • Knowledge Center
  • Client Resources

    • Client Resources
    • Avoid Overdraft Fees
    • Banking Holidays
    • Frequently Asked Questions
    • News
    • Reorder Checks
    • Schedule of Charges

    Account Support and Safety

    • Protect Your Accounts
    • Fraud Recovery Checklist
    • Protect Yourself from Popular Fraud Scams
    • Mailbox Fishing Scams
    • Fraud Prevention Articles

    Contact Us

    • Employee Directory
    • Find a Branch
    • General Inquiries
    • Loan Services
    • Online Banking Help
    • Send a Message

    Frequently Asked Questions

    • I lost my NB Debit Card but the bank is closed. Is there a number I can call?
    • What is Needham Bank's routing number?
    • How do I enroll in Online Banking?
    • How do I avoid overdraft fees?
  • Contact Us
  • About
  • Community
  • Careers
  • Enroll in Online Banking
Customer Care Center: 781-444-2100

Multi-Factor Authentication: How to Secure Your Bank Accounts

Posted on 1/24/2022

Have you ever logged in to an online account and received a text message to confirm it was you that was logging in? This is becoming pretty common nowadays with online accounts that include your sensitive information.

This security measure is called multi-factor authentication because you need more than one kind of verification to prove your identity and access your account.

We partnered with cybersecurity expert Ryan Barratt, Founder and Chief Executive Officer of ORAM Corporate Advisors, to explain what multi-factor authentication is and its benefits. Read Ryan’s answers below.

  1. What is multi-factor authentication?

Multi-factor authentication (MFA), sometimes referred to as two-factor authentication, is an added layer of security that requires more than one form of verification of a user’s identity. This can range from answering security questions to requiring a one-time PIN provided via smartphone for access to email, an app, or a virtual private network (VPN).

  1. What are the benefits of multi-factor authentication?

By using MFA for everything from apps to email, you are doubling your login protection. Regardless of the length and strength of your passwords, a breach is always a possibility. As soon as a cybercriminal has your personal information, you can be hacked.

Enabling MFA ensures that the only person who has access to your accounts, email, apps, and more is you. This is true for everything from social media accounts to your banking account and business email. Even if a cybercriminal figures out your login and password, with MFA, they won’t be able to access your data.

Yes, there is an extra step involved in using MFA that takes a little more time, but the added security makes it worth the effort and time.

  1. What can I use multi-factor authentication for?

MFA can be used for a variety of logins. From emails to social media and bank accounts, MFA can help keep your personal information private.

Many companies support multi-factor authentication including social media platforms Facebook, Instagram, LinkedIn, Twitter, Snapchat, and TikTok. Other popular accounts such as Amazon, Apple, Google, Microsoft, PayPal, and more have this security option.

  1. Can I use multi-factor authentication for my bank accounts?

Yes. In addition to receiving a one-time passcode via voice call or text messages, you can sync an authenticator app to your consumer online banking profile.

First, you will need to download an authenticator application. There are many different apps that you can choose from, and companies like Google and Microsoft offer versions of an authenticator app.

If you are a new registrant for NB Online Banking, you will see an option to set up MFA during your registration and initial login.

If you are an existing NB Online Banking user, you can navigate to “My Settings” in online or mobile banking, then scroll to “Security Options” and enable the MFA feature. Turn the “By authenticator” switch on and click “Save.” Then, scan the QR code or enter the presented code into the authenticator app of your choice. You will see a success screen on your authenticator app to confirm registration.

Multi-factor authentication is a simple way to add security to your online logins. By downloading an authentication app and syncing it with your online and mobile bank login, your personal information will be better protected. If you have any questions about setting up MFA for your online banking account, please call 781-444-2100 and press 2.

ORAM Corporate Advisors is a company that offers consulting services to organizations whose data is critical to their business. Massachusetts Lawyers Weekly 2020 Reader Ranking Awards ranked ORAM Corporate Advisors in the top two cybersecurity firms in Massachusetts. Ryan Barrett, Founder and Chief Executive Officer of ORAM, holds a Bachelor of Science Degree in Computer Engineering from Wentworth Institute of Technology and he serves on Needham Bank’s Advisory Council. For more information about ORAM, visit https://www.oramca.com/.

Similar Posts

NB Online Banking: Browser Settings and HTTP Cookies 12/9/2021
COVID Planning for 2021: Protecting Your Business in the Year Ahead 3/1/2021

Knowledge Center

Category

  • All
  • Calculators
  • Borrowing
  • Fraud Prevention
  • Home Ownership
  • Managing Debt
  • Retirement & Wealth
  • Saving & Budgeting
  • Small Businesses
  • Students

PLEASE NOTE:

You are leaving the Needham Bank website. By clicking "Continue" below, you will enter a website created, operated, and maintained by a private business or organization. 

Needham Bank provides this link as a service to our website visitors. We are not responsible for the content, views, or privacy policies of this site. 

We take no responsibility for any products or services offered by this site, nor do we endorse or sponsor the information it contains. 

Continue to leave the Needham Bank site.
OR
Stay here to close this message.

  • Home
  • Locations
  • Contact us
  • About
  • Careers
  • Account Support & Safety
  • Privacy Policy
  • TERMS OF USE
Member FDIC Equal Housing Lender Member DIF
© 2023 All rights reserved. Powered by Getfused